python中二分支语句
在人类的编程世界中,有一门很受欢迎的语言,那就是Python。它像一只机敏灵活的猫头鹰,在黑暗中寻找着答案。而在Python这个广阔的森林里,隐藏着一个神奇的技巧,那就是二分支语句。
当我们写代码时,经常需要根据条件的不同采取不同的行动。比如说,你打算出门玩耍,但是天空中阴云密布,这时候你会做出什么决定呢?是继续出门狂欢,还是待在家里跳舞呢?这种选择就像是你在Python中使用二分支语句时所面临的抉择。
让我们一起来看看二分支语句的具体用法吧!
if…else…语句:条件判断的精髓
在Python中,if…else…语句是最基本、最常用的二分支结构之一。它就像是一道岔路口,要么你按照某个条件走左边,要么走右边。
假设你想编写一个程序,判断一个数是正数还是负数。那么你可以这样写:
num = 10 if num > 0: print("这个数是正数") else: print("这个数是负数")
当num大于0时,程序会输出“这个数是正数”,否则会输出“这个数是负数”。就像你站在岔路口,左边通向ipipgo明媚的大道,右边则是一片阴暗的小巷。
多重二分支语句:选择的茫茫人海
有时候,一个二分支结构可能无法满足我们的需求,我们需要更多的选择。这时候,我们可以使用多重二分支语句,就像在人海中选择自己喜欢的伴侣一样。
假设你想根据学生的考试成绩评级,你可以这样写代码:
score = 80 if score >= 90: print("优秀") elif score >= 80: print("良好") elif score >= 70: print("中等") elif score >= 60: print("及格") else: print("不及格")
这段代码根据不同的分数段打印出相应的评级。和你站在舞池中,眼前是一群璀璨的星星,每颗星星都代表着不同的评级。
三元操作符:简洁的选择
除了if…else…语句和多重二分支语句,Python还提供了一种简洁的选择方式,那就是三元操作符。它就像是你手中的一把快刀,可以迅速解决问题。
假设你想找出两个数中的最大值,你可以这样使用三元操作符:
a = 10 b = 5 max_num = a if a > b else b print(max_num)
这段代码会打印出两个数中的较大值。就像你手中拿着一枚硬币,通过抛掷决定下一个行动,正面则选择a,反面则选择b。
总结
二分支语句是Python编程中非常重要的一部分,它让我们能够根据不同的条件做出不同的决策。无论是简单的if…else…语句,还是更复杂的多重二分支语句和三元操作符,它们都是我们编程旅途中的得力助手。
就像你面对生活中的选择,要么选择继续冒险,要么选择安逸舒适。在Python的世界里,二分支语句为我们创造了无穷的可能性,让我们掌握着代码的主导权。
所以,让我们一起在Python的森林中,驾驭二分支语句的神奇力量吧!
本文链接:http://so.lmcjl.com/news/17830/